Study of defibrillator implants for non-ischemic weak heart
This study looks at whether implantable defibrillators can reduce dangerous heart rhythms in people with non-ischemic cardiomyopathy (heart weakness not caused by blocked heart arteries), a heart scar, and very low pumping strength despite best treatment. It compares different approaches to choosing which patients should receive these devices.

Interferon-gamma added to antifungals for chronic lung fungus
This study tests whether adding interferon-gamma injections to standard antifungal treatment helps people with chronic pulmonary aspergillosis (CPA). Because it’s a feasibility study, the main goal is to see if the added treatment can be given safely and whether visits and measurements work smoothly.

Stem cell treatment for long-lasting chest pain not helped by meds
This Phase 2 trial tests whether stem cells placed into the heart artery can safely reduce symptoms in people with “refractory” angina (chest pain) despite maximum heart-healthy medication. You may qualify if your chest pain is limiting your activity and other heart procedures (stents/bypass) aren’t possible or are too risky.

Time-restricted eating to improve heart and sugar health
This study tests whether eating only within a set daily time window can improve cardiometabolic health (things like blood sugar and heart-related measures). You may be eligible if you have overweight and borderline/high-risk blood sugar but do not have diabetes and can follow the eating and testing rules.
